Q1: Why 2.0g protein per kg of body weight?
A: This amount supports muscle protein synthesis while creating a caloric deficit for weight loss, helping preserve lean mass during fat loss.
Q2: Are these recommendations suitable for everyone?
A: These are general guidelines. Individual needs may vary based on activity level, metabolism, and specific goals. Consult a nutritionist for personalized advice.
Q3: How should I distribute these macros throughout the day?
A: Spread protein intake evenly across meals. Time carbohydrates around workouts. Include healthy fats with each meal for optimal nutrient absorption.
Q4: Should I adjust these values over time?
A: Yes, recalculate as your weight changes. Monitor progress and adjust based on results and how your body responds.
Q5: What about total calorie intake?
A: While macros are important, total calorie balance (deficit for weight loss, surplus for muscle building) is fundamental. Track both for best results.
